Gostava de deixar aqui uma breve explicação que ele deu sobre as kessils e a experiencia que tem tido com elas:
I started with 5 kessil narrows accross this tank. Awesome for all the corals under the lights, but I found SPS that weren't in a decent amount of direct light to be "reaching." I have since added two more kessil wides in the back, as well as the ecoxotic strip lights. I have over 800 watts of LED's on the tank, and I run them ALL at 100% intensity. I read a lot of threads that run the lights at less than 50% intensity. Not really sure why. It's good to give a coral some acclimation time, but the corals need the light (assuming SPS of coarse). There are SO many other reasons for corals to be having problems.....lighting is not the first one I would think of. I have corals thriving at less than 8" under water that are directly under 90 watt narrow kessils sitting less than 10" off the water. These corals grow nice and thick. I have stags with branches thicker than my thumb. Some of my Tortes are just as thick. So, I believe LED's have plenty of power to grow sweet / Thick / beautiful corals. You just need to make sure you have enough light to cover the tank well. And don't be afraid to use it.
